A community care provider is hiring Care Assistants in the Dundonald area. The role involves supporting elderly and vulnerable people with personal care and meal preparation. Candidates need not have prior experience as comprehensive training is provided.

The position offers up to £13.60 hourly, flexible schedules, and various benefits, including a staff early pay app and mental health support. Only female candidates will be considered due to the nature of the role, which requires working closely with female clients.
